Finland combines advanced automation with harsh operating conditions and a small labour pool, so reliability, remote diagnostics and low-manning operation weigh heavily in equipment evaluation. Energy performance and heat recovery are usually central to the investment case.
How do you source industrial equipment for a project in Finland?
Define the product, process and target capacity first, then convert that into a single comparable equipment scope. Issue that identical scope to qualified manufacturers — including origins that affect financing eligibility — and compare the responses on technology, capacity, lead time, installation, commissioning, spares and payment terms rather than headline price. In Finland the strongest current project areas are food and beverage processing, cold storage and freezing, aquaculture and fish processing, feed and bioprocessing. Financing, where required, is screened in parallel rather than after award, because equipment origin and project structure determine which routes are open.

CAPEX planning
Total project cost in Finland is rarely the equipment price alone. Freight, insurance, duties, installation, commissioning, civil works, utilities, engineering and contingency all move the number — and they move it differently depending on equipment origin and site readiness.

Why the Finland market matters
Finland's industrial base pairs advanced automation and process engineering with harsh operating conditions and a small domestic labour pool. Equipment is expected to run reliably in cold climates with minimal manning, so control systems, remote diagnostics and predictable maintenance carry more weight in evaluations than in milder, labour-rich markets.
Energy intensity is the second factor. Processing, cold storage and forestry-adjacent manufacturing all consume significant power, and investment cases are routinely built on energy performance and heat recovery. Those cases only stand up when every supplier has priced the same measured basis and the same integration scope.

Procurement pain points in Finland
These are the recurring failure points we see in Finland equipment projects. Each one is addressed by what goes into the written scope before suppliers are approached.
Winterisation assumed
Suppliers unfamiliar with Nordic conditions quote standard packages that need costly modification on site.
Remote-support capability unverified
Diagnostics, remote access and response commitments are rarely written into the scope despite being central to low-manning operation.
Integration scope excluded
Controls and data integration into existing systems is left out of the first quotation and negotiated later at a disadvantage.
Efficiency claims not comparable
Without a fixed measurement basis, energy performance figures cannot be evaluated against one another.

Import and export flows
Specialised processing equipment is imported from across Europe and Asia while Finnish automation and process technology is exported widely. Equipment origin influences lead time, service coverage and export-credit eligibility and is compared explicitly.
EPC and installation coordination
Cold-season constraints and short shutdown windows make sequencing critical. Interfaces between mechanical, electrical, automation and civil scopes are documented before award.
